Role purposeA Research Group Senior Manager is required to support the activities of the Precision Measurement Group at the Institute for Photonics at the University of Adelaide. This award-winning team of 25 people has demonstrated success in developing very high-performance quantum technologies. These devices have been validated in both international and national field trials, in real-world environments, and with high value partners. The research group is formed from a diverse team of both physicists and engineers, some working remotely, and with a wide range of skillsets. The team's activities bridge from proof-of-concept testing in the laboratory to delivery of fully automated, turn-key systems for use in real-world environments. The group is one of the best funded groups in Australia with a broad range of sponsors with complex milestones and deliverables. The team needs support to ensure that tasks are achieved on schedule and on budget while also working closely with industry partners to ensure commercialization of the outputs of the group. This is an opportunity to work with some of the nation's best researchers and assist them to see their efforts turned into real-world impact.
